Summary
The information technology revolution transformed work into complex, networked processes requiring skilled users. New structures are needed to manage user learning, error reduction, and support services for evolving information technologies.

Background:
- The digital revolution has shifted work from linear to complex, networked operations.
- Modern work increasingly relies on both advanced information technology and proficient user engagement.
- This transformation creates intricate interdependencies between technology, users, skills, and management strategies.
Purpose of the Study:
- To highlight the critical role of user skills in the information technology revolution.
- To propose a new framework for managing the integration of new users and technologies in the workplace.
- To address the challenges posed by complexity, continuous learning, and human error in IT-dependent work environments.
Main Methods:
- Conceptual analysis of the impact of information technology on work processes.
- Review of interdependencies between technology, user skills, and organizational policies.
- Identification of key areas for improved user management and support.
Main Results:
- Workplace dynamics are now characterized by fast-paced, networked processes.
- Successful technology adoption hinges on skilled users and effective management of their learning and performance.
- New support services are essential for the deployment and administration of information technologies.
Conclusions:
- A structured approach is necessary to manage the learning and performance of users in complex IT environments.
- Emphasis must be placed on user adaptability, tolerance for continuous learning, and usability.
- Minimizing human error and providing robust support services are crucial for successful technology integration.
